在計(jì)算機(jī)軟件技術(shù)開(kāi)發(fā)領(lǐng)域,卓越的技能如同精準(zhǔn)的三支飛鏢,直中目標(biāo),展現(xiàn)著開(kāi)發(fā)者解決復(fù)雜問(wèn)題、創(chuàng)造高效解決方案的專業(yè)能力。這三支“鏢”,分別代表了扎實(shí)的基礎(chǔ)知識(shí)、創(chuàng)新的思維模式與高效的協(xié)作精神,共同構(gòu)成了軟件開(kāi)發(fā)的核心競(jìng)爭(zhēng)力。
第一鏢:扎實(shí)的基礎(chǔ)知識(shí)與技術(shù)功底
卓越的軟件開(kāi)發(fā)者首先必須具備深厚的技術(shù)根基。這包括對(duì)編程語(yǔ)言(如Java、Python、C++等)的精通,對(duì)數(shù)據(jù)結(jié)構(gòu)與算法的深刻理解,以及對(duì)操作系統(tǒng)、網(wǎng)絡(luò)原理、數(shù)據(jù)庫(kù)設(shè)計(jì)等核心概念的掌握。這些知識(shí)如同鏢盤的中心,是每一次精準(zhǔn)命中的基礎(chǔ)。在實(shí)踐中,開(kāi)發(fā)者需不斷學(xué)習(xí)新技術(shù)、跟進(jìn)行業(yè)趨勢(shì),通過(guò)實(shí)際項(xiàng)目磨練技能,確保代碼的質(zhì)量與可維護(hù)性。例如,在開(kāi)發(fā)高性能應(yīng)用時(shí),對(duì)算法優(yōu)化和內(nèi)存管理的深入理解能顯著提升軟件效率。
第二鏢:創(chuàng)新的思維模式與問(wèn)題解決能力
軟件技術(shù)開(kāi)發(fā)不僅是代碼的堆砌,更是創(chuàng)造性解決問(wèn)題的過(guò)程。卓越的開(kāi)發(fā)者需具備系統(tǒng)思維和邏輯分析能力,能夠?qū)?fù)雜需求分解為可執(zhí)行的模塊,并設(shè)計(jì)出優(yōu)雅的架構(gòu)。創(chuàng)新體現(xiàn)在對(duì)新技術(shù)的探索和應(yīng)用,如人工智能、云計(jì)算、區(qū)塊鏈等領(lǐng)域的融合,以及用戶體驗(yàn)的優(yōu)化。在敏捷開(kāi)發(fā)環(huán)境中,快速迭代和適應(yīng)變化的能力也至關(guān)重要。開(kāi)發(fā)者應(yīng)像投鏢者調(diào)整角度一樣,靈活應(yīng)對(duì)項(xiàng)目中的不確定性,通過(guò)原型設(shè)計(jì)和測(cè)試驅(qū)動(dòng)開(kāi)發(fā)來(lái)降低風(fēng)險(xiǎn)。
第三鏢:高效的協(xié)作精神與團(tuán)隊(duì)溝通
軟件開(kāi)發(fā)往往是團(tuán)隊(duì)協(xié)作的結(jié)果,卓越的技能離不開(kāi)有效的溝通與合作。開(kāi)發(fā)者需在版本控制(如Git)、代碼審查、持續(xù)集成等工具的支持下,與產(chǎn)品經(jīng)理、設(shè)計(jì)師、測(cè)試人員緊密配合,確保項(xiàng)目順利推進(jìn)。良好的文檔編寫和知識(shí)分享習(xí)慣,能提升團(tuán)隊(duì)整體效率。在跨文化或遠(yuǎn)程團(tuán)隊(duì)中,溝通技巧更是關(guān)鍵,幫助避免誤解和沖突,促進(jìn)創(chuàng)新想法的碰撞。
計(jì)算機(jī)軟件技術(shù)開(kāi)發(fā)中的卓越技能,正是這三鏢齊發(fā)的完美體現(xiàn):以扎實(shí)基礎(chǔ)為支撐,以創(chuàng)新思維為驅(qū)動(dòng),以高效協(xié)作為紐帶。隨著技術(shù)的飛速發(fā)展,開(kāi)發(fā)者需持續(xù)投擲這三支鏢,不斷命中新的目標(biāo),推動(dòng)軟件行業(yè)向更高水平邁進(jìn)。無(wú)論是開(kāi)發(fā)一個(gè)簡(jiǎn)單的應(yīng)用還是構(gòu)建復(fù)雜的系統(tǒng),這三鏢的平衡與精準(zhǔn),都將決定項(xiàng)目的成功與否。
如若轉(zhuǎn)載,請(qǐng)注明出處:http://www.51xmu.cn/product/61.html
更新時(shí)間:2026-04-08 21:12:17